Thursday evening into Friday, I took some time to compression test it and then do a leak down test. Compression Test Results:
Dry Test
#1-145 psi
#2-140 psi
#3-130 psi
#4-130 psi
#5-140 psi
#6-131 psi
Not great but not bad for 221,000 miles. Decided to add a little oil into each cylinder and re-test it. (I used a bit too much oil.)
Wet Test
#1-220 psi
#2-195 psi
#3-216 psi
#4-198 psi
#5-220 psi
#6-195 psi
Next, I went to Harbor Freight and bought a Leak Down Tester. What a piece of sh*t, the fittings were leaking when I took it out of the box. But, it did the job. I didn't pull the timing cover so I had to guess at TDC. I stuck an extension down each cylinder and then turned the crank until I got to what I marked as the highest point on the extension. Not exactly scientific but it worked.
Highest Leak Down # was 22%, lowest was 18%. Considering they probably weren't exactly TDC, I'm happy.
These numbers, combined with how well it runs, leads me to highly doubt it has a cracked head. This is further supported by the fact that there is no mixing of oil and coolant.
